A Dutch silver empire tea-service and later stand with lamp
Maker's mark of Jan Laurensen, Amsterdam, 1835-1839; maker's mark indistinct, The Netherlands, 1853
Comprising: a teapot with wooden handle; a milkjug; a teacaddy and a stand with lamp on wooden base, each on rectangular domed base rising to a shaped rectangular body with reeded upperrim, the teapot and caddy with high domed hinged covers and a gadrooned shaped finial, the milkjug with helmet spout
15.2cm. high
marked on reverse
1002gr. (without stand) (3)
